4) About MITSFT ?
  • The MIT School of Film and Theatre was established in 2015 to fulfill the upcoming needs of this sector. Set up under the leadership of Dr Jabbar Patel, the well-known film director, the MIT School of Film and Theatre trains individuals in the disciplines of Film Direction and Screen Play writing, Film Editing, Cinematography, Sound Recording and Design and Visual Effects.
  • MIT School of Film and Theatre (SFT) is housed in its own building on the picturesque banks of the River Mutha in Loni. This building houses the classrooms and studios of the various departments of MIT-SFT. Pune's largest film and Theatre shooting studio is coming up within this  building, and will create endless opportunities for MIT SFT's students to interact with the cinema media industries without leaving their campus.
5) Highlights/ USP/ Significance:
  • The BSc and MSc curriculum at MITSFT is designed in consideration of Indian as well as international film industry norms and the degrees are recognized by  UGC - University grants commission of India.
  • MIT-ADTU is located in the 125 acre campus at Rajbaug, Loni, on the banks of the Mutha River, offering diverse locations for students to practise their filmmaking skills, as it is also  the abode of legendary filmmaker Raj Kapoor where his International acclaimed films were produced. Pune is considered Oxford of the east and a cultural capital of India.
  • As a part of the University system, Non-Core Subjects like Political Science, History of Art (painting and Sculpture), Sociology, Introduction to the Performing Arts, Psychology, Introduction to Indian and Western Classical Music, Introduction to Literature etc, are all a part of the syllabus. These subjects help the students grow their minds to get ready for a career in filmmaking, as they receive all round education in media which could be qualified as a 360 degree perspective in media.
  • MITSFT offers over thirty units of cameras, editing and sound recording systems, that permit each student to experiment and learn with equipment on a one-to-one basis.
  • MITSFT offers a dedicated shooting studio for camera workshops, and shortly, the largest air-conditioned shooting studio in Pune.
  • MITSFT offers dedicated audio workstations to train people in Sound Design and Audio Post-Production for films and theatre.
  • All faculty are alumni of prestigious institutes such as Film & Theatre Institute of India and Satyajit Ray Film & Theatre Institute.
